Chicken Gnocchi Soup
This Chicken Gnocchi Soup is hearty and comforting with big chunks of chicken, sweet carrots, and soft pillowy gnocchi cradled in a creamy broth. Using a pre-made rotisserie chicken makes this soup come together in under 30 minutes, perfect for a weeknight dinner.

📝 Preparation Steps
1
In a large stock pot or dutch oven,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add in onion and celery, sauté for ⏱️ 4-5 minutes, until veggies are softened. Add in garlic and cook for ⏱️ 20 seconds until fragrant. Stir in the flour and cook for ⏱️ 1 minute more until no white patches remain.

2
Slowly whisk in the chicken broth until combined with the flour mixture and no lumps remain. Bring to a gentle simmer.

3
Add in the thyme, salt, pepper, rushed red pepper flakes, gnocchi, chicken, and carrots. Bring back to a simmer and cook for ⏱️ 5-6 minutes, until the gnocchi are cooked through and the carrots are tender.

4
Add in the spinach and cream and cook until the mixture comes back up to a simmer and the spinach is wilted. (Do not bring to a boil.) Serve hot and enjoy!
